1. 程式人生 > >Jenkins構建Python專案提示:'python' 不是內部或外部命令,也不是可執行的程式

Jenkins構建Python專案提示:'python' 不是內部或外部命令,也不是可執行的程式

問題描述:

jenkin整合python專案,立即構建後,發現未執行成功,檢視Console Output 提示:'Python' 不是內部或外部命令,也不是可執行的程式,如下圖:

1.在 Windows 提示符下執行是沒有問題。

2.把Jenkins專案配置中 python main.py   修改成python可執行檔案全路徑:D:\Python35\python.exe main.py ,再次構建也沒有問題。

這是因為 Jenkins 缺少環境配置。

解決方法:

配置構建執行狀態:

1.回到 Jenkins 首頁,點選 “構建執行狀態”或“Build Executor Status” ,右則會列出本機資訊。

2.點選本機設定按鈕,配置 Python 的 path 環境變數。同時還需要新增瀏覽器驅動檔案所在目錄。

3.最後一定要記得儲存哦。